I have not seen any, but read there are some compression couplings that allow you to install pigtails of copper to the aluminum wiring. It does take a special compression tool as the common compression type pliers do not have enough force to do the job.

That is an immersion detector, similar to a GFCI except the reference point is to a wire ring inside the throat of the hair dryer, not in imbalance of the in and out current.

It is the Copalum connector that requires a special tool and a certified installer. If you have room in the boxes there is also the Alumiconn, from King Innovation that is essentially a small bus bar in an insulated enclosure and each lug is Cu/Al rated. The Ideal 65 (purple) is U/L listed and still technically legal. It is the CPSC that doesn't like them. US and Canada disagree on a number of similar devices so I am not surprised that they like their home grown Marrette and not our Wirenut. Aluminum wire is an interesting thing. All aluminum wire is not bad. If the alloy is AAxx it is OK, It was only the original 6250 that was the problem but once the reputation was established the myth continued. The problem also only involved binding screw connections. Wire in lugs was never a problem it they were properly torqued. A loose connection is never good.

Copalum certified installers in Canada are scarcer than hen's teeth. The certification cost and rental cost of the tools (they can not be purchaced - or at least they were not available in Canada 5 years ago) makes the cost per termination daunting to say the least. Terminations run $15 to $25 per connection. Allumicons are also CSA approved and cost about $3 each in quantiitee uphere - and require a calibrated torque scewdriver for reliable installation. Common adjustable torque drivers run close to $300. Presets run around $100 each for decent quality name brand tools.

The thermoplastic purple ideal connectors are a small increment better than leaving the aluminum wiring alone. The biggest problem is IF the sonnection overheats the ideal is flammable - the ACS is not. The design of the "coil" in the connector is also different - and the ideal is inferior. It has NOTHING to do with the Marrette being Canadian and the Ideal american.Canadian electrical standards are significantly more stringent than American regs
